Skip to main content
QUICK REVIEW

[논문 리뷰] Fluid Communities: A Competitive and Highly Scalable Community Detection Algorithm

Ferran Parés, Dario García-Gasulla|arXiv (Cornell University)|2017. 03. 27.
Complex Network Analysis Techniques인용 수 4
한 줄 요약

Fluid Communities는 유체 역학에 영감을 받은 매우 확장 가능한 경쟁적 커뮤니티 탐지 알고리즘으로, 노드들이 상호작용을 통해 레이블을 확산시켜 동적 커뮤니티 형성을 가능하게 한다. 이 알고리즘은 합성 그래프에서 최신 기술 수준의 정확도를 달성하면서도, 커뮤니티 수를 변동 가능하게 탐지할 수 있는 최초의 전파 기반 방법이 되었으며, 커뮤니티 다양성 측면에서 기존 대안들보다 뚜렷이 뛰어나다.

ABSTRACT

We introduce a community detection algorithm (Fluid Communities) based on the idea of fluids interacting in an environment, expanding and contracting as a result of that interaction. Fluid Communities is based on the propagation methodology, which represents the state-of-the-art in terms of computational cost and scalability. While being highly efficient, Fluid Communities is able to find communities in synthetic graphs with an accuracy close to the current best alternatives. Additionally, Fluid Communities is the first propagation-based algorithm capable of identifying a variable number of communities in network. To illustrate the relevance of the algorithm, we evaluate the diversity of the communities found by Fluid Communities, and find them to be significantly different from the ones found by alternative methods.

연구 동기 및 목표

  • 고정된 커뮤니티 수를 요구하지 않으면서도 높은 확장성과 정확도를 유지하는 커뮤니티 탐지 알고리즘 개발
  • 기존 전파 기반 방법의 한계를 해결함: 일반적으로 커뮤니티 수를 사전에 고정함
  • 최신 기술 수준의 대안들보다 커뮤니티의 다양성을 향상시킴
  • 유체 유사한 전파 메커니즘을 통해 대규모 네트워크 분석을 효율적으로 가능하게 함

제안 방법

  • 알고리즘은 노드를 유체 입자로 모델링하여 국소적 상호작용에 따라 팽창 및 수축하도록 설계하여 네트워크 환경에서 유체 역학을 시뮬레이션함
  • 각 노드가 이웃 노드들 중에서 가장 빈도가 높은 레이블을 선택하는 레이블 전파 메커니즘을 사용하며, 이는 유체 유사한 팽창 및 수축에 의해 동적으로 조정됨
  • 커뮤니티 경계는 레이블 전파의 수렴에 의해 결정되며, 유체 역학이 커뮤니티의 형성과 융합에 영향을 미침
  • 지속적인 상호작용과 레이블의 안정화를 통해 알고리즘이 자동으로 커뮤니티 수를 결정함
  • 밀도가 높은 영역에 있는 노드들이 더 적극적으로 레이블을 전파함으로써 커뮤니티의 유대감을 증진하는 경쟁 메커니즘을 활용함
  • 높은 계산 효율성을 고려하여 대규모 네트워크에 대한 확장성을 확보함

실험 결과

연구 질문

  • RQ1유체 역학에 영감을 받은 모델은 계산 확장성과 함께 높은 정확도를 달성할 수 있는가?
  • RQ2전파 기반 알고리즘이 사전 지정 없이 변동 가능한 커뮤니티 수를 동적으로 탐지할 수 있는가?
  • RQ3Fluid Communities가 탐지한 커뮤니티의 다양성은 기존 방법들과 비교해 어떻게 다른가?
  • RQ4유체 유사한 역학은 커뮤니티 구조 형성과 안정성에 어떤 영향을 미치는가?

주요 결과

  • Fluid Communities는 합성 그래프에서 현재 최신 기술 수준의 방법들과 유사한 정확도를 달성함
  • 사전에 커뮤니티 수를 지정할 필요 없이 변동 가능한 커뮤니티 수를 탐지할 수 있는 최초의 전파 기반 알고리즘임
  • Fluid Communities가 탐지한 커뮤니티들은 다른 알고리즘에 비해 뚜렷이 더 높은 다양성을 보임
  • 알고리즘이 높은 계산 효율성을 유지하여 대규모 네트워크 분석에 적합함

더 나은 연구,지금 바로 시작하세요

연구 설계부터 논문 작성까지, 연구 시간을 획기적으로 줄여보세요.

카드 등록 없음 · 무료 플랜 제공

이 리뷰는 AI가 만들고, 인간 에디터가 검토했습니다.